In a close match on Senior Day, the Santa Clara Broncos' beach volleyball team narrowly lost to the Gaels after initially securing a 2-0 lead.
By the Numbers- Saint Mary's defeated Santa Clara 3-2.
- Radeff and Kishton from Santa Clara won their match 21-18, 21-17.
- Epstein and Urbina secured a victory at the five slot with a 21-11, 21-11 score.
Despite a strong start and individual victories, Santa Clara was unable to secure an overall win against Saint Mary's.
State of Play- Santa Clara honored eight seniors and a practice player on Senior Day.
- The Broncos' upcoming matches are against Bakersfield and Pacific in Stockton.
The Broncos will travel to Stockton to face Bakersfield and Pacific in their next matches.
